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
702237 0846732634 30739
4532926 58
4532926 58
99 765124 17 7165258624
All about undefined
Interested in learning more?
4532926 58
99 765124 17 7165258624
See more
572209144 6035713
1514 11000769 59027971893
See more
7975994958 028749 917794765
5720923 295304 54703 6523
See more